PRIMROSE COTTAGE, Ballater Holiday Cottages, Ballater, Royal Deeside, Aberdeenshire
Recently refurbished single storey cottage in heart of Royal Deeside, ideally suited for couples and singles, sleeps 2.

Ballater is a pretty little village, centred around a picturesque green, where pipe bands play regularly throughout the summer. As well as shopping at the Royal butcher and baker, you can browse in the many excellent shops for antiques, books, country clothing, interior design and gifts. Golfers can choose from many excellent courses nearby, there is plenty of good quality fishing with permits available in local shops, and pony-trekking and gliding nearby. The Victorian Heritage, Whisky and Castle trails add an extra dimension when touring by car.

Primrose Cottage is in the garden of our own house. It was converted from outbuildings some thirty years ago, and has recently been totally refurbished. Just a couple of minutes walk from the centre of the village, it is convenient for shops and restaurants. The accommodation is geared to meet the needs of couples or single people and provides excellent value for a holiday or a short break when you just want to escape for a few days.

The kitchen is modern and fully equipped with everything we think you will need. A previous guest pointed out the need for a tea cosy, so she could enjoy a leisurely breakfast without the tea going cold! As well as the usual kettle and toaster, there is an electric hob and oven and a microwave for when you just want a quick snack. The fridge has a freezer compartment, and there is a washing machine with integral tumble drier. There is a table which seats two. The sitting room has a comfortable sofa and armchair, perfect for curling up and relaxing with a good book. This is especially recommended in winter, in front of the open fire. There is a television, DVD player and CD player/radio, and a selection of books and games if you want to forget about the outside world for a while. We have also provided some maps and details of local walks, as well as some other information and phone numbers which you may find useful. The bedroom is fresh and bright, with a comfortable, traditional brass bed and pine furniture. The bathroom has an instant shower, so there is plenty of hot water for a reviving shower after all those long walks. There is also a wash hand basin and WC.

CRAIGEN COTTAGE, Ballater Holiday Cottages, Ballater, Royal Deeside, Aberdeenshire
Detached 19th Century cottage, renovated to a high standard, close to village centre, sleeps 6.

Craigen is a detached cottage, built at the end of the 19th century using the local pink granite. It has been renovated to a high standard, and provides pleasant holiday accommodation with comfort and character. Just a couple of minutes walk from the centre of the village, it is convenient for shops and restaurants. The front of the house is smothered in roses and honeysuckle, and the garden is filled with shrubs and traditional cottage flowers such as delphiniums and hollyhocks. The fully enclosed back garden is private, and mainly laid to lawn, with a table and chairs for alfresco dining. The kitchen is fully equipped, including a table which seats six easily, built in ceramic hob and double oven with grill. The kitchen is a lovely bright room with windows to front and rear, a traditional Belfast sink and solid wood worktops. The Sitting Room has an open fireplace, solid oak flooring, two deep, comfortable settees and big, comfortable armchair, as well as a television, DVD player and a portable CD player and radio. The twin bedroom is off the kitchen, overlooking the back garden, and is ideal for anyone who finds stairs difficult. The shower room has a small sink, toilet and instant shower, giving hot water all the time for as many showers as you want. The double bedroom is upstairs, with comfortable generous pine bed, dormer window and traditional sloping ceilings. The upstairs twin bedroom has pine beds and again has a dormer window and sloping ceilings. Bathroom with bath, sink and W.C.

Hidden away in a secluded position just 2 miles from Balmoral Castle (the Queen‘s holiday retreat), this picturesque house is reached by its own wooden bridge. Beautifully kept, it provides very comfortable accommodation with a unique character and charm. The cottage has a fairytale setting with the Geldie Burn and the Genechal Burn forming its boundaries on two sides, and the fir-clad Creag nam Ban hill rising behind it. On the ground floor there is a bright, split level sitting room and sun room, with an open fire and comfortable settees. The pine kitchen is fully equipped, and the dining room has an open fire. The twin bedroom has lovely views over the Dee Valley, while the single bedroom looks East - you may find yourself face to face with a herd of cows when you open the curtains! The shower room has a w.c. and wash hand basin. Upstairs there are two light, bright bedrooms, one twin and one double, both with lovely views. The bathroom has a bath, shower, w.c. and wash hand basin. The garden has a lawn, flower and shrub borders, a paved seating area with table and chairs.

BLUEFOLDS HIGHLAND COTTAGES, Glenlivet, Cairngorms National Park, Moray
Stunning panoramic views to the mountains in the Cairngorms National Park sleeps 2-8.

£330 - £750

  

Visit Scotland Scheme 4 Star award - Green Tourism Bronze award

There are panoramic mountain views from your south facing lounge patio windows, combined with peace and tranquillity, at Bluefolds Holiday Cottages. The 4 cottages are in a tastefully restored farm steading and farmhouse. This stunning location is at the centre of the Malt Whisky Trail with the Glenlivet, Glenfiddich, Glenfarclas and Aberlour distilleries in a 10 mile radius from the cottages. There are also historic castles, idyllic fishing villages or beautiful empty beaches on the Moray Firth coast to visit.

Situated on a hillside, in open farmland, the cottages have an unrivalled location in remote Glenlivet in the Cairngorms National Park. The cottages are double glazed with modern kitchens, centrally heated and comfortably furnished with CD/ radio players, digital satellite TV and DVD/VHS players as well as coal fired stoves as a feature in the steading lounges. The farmhouse has a coal fired stove in the kitchen. Pets welcome by arrangement.

Dronach (sleeps 6) has an open plan lounge/dining area, modern kitchen, shower room and 2 large bedrooms (each with 1 double and 1 single bed); Aberlour (sleeps 5) has an open plan lounge/dining area, modern kitchen, shower room and two bedrooms (1 twin, 1 with 1 double and 1 single bed); Glenlivet (sleeps 6), arranged on one level (with 5 steps from lounge to kitchen), has a large open plan lounge/dining area, modern kitchen, bathroom and 3 bedrooms (2 large bedrooms with 1 double and 1 single bed (suitable either as twin or doubles), and 1 double room); Folds (sleeps 8) has an open plan lounge/dining area, separate kitchen and utility room and 3 bedrooms (2 large bedrooms upstairs with 1 double and 1 single bed and wash basins, and 1 double with ensuite shower room and toilet downstairs).
